Pulled-Pork Sandwich

Ingredients

  • 1 teas. salt
  • 1/4 teas. black pepper
  • 1/8 teas. cayenne pepper
  • 3 to 4 pounds pork butt
  • 3 Tbls. butter
  • 1 c. ketchup
  • 1 c. pineapple juice
  • 1/2 c. brown sugar
  • 3 Tbls. molasses
  • 1 Tbls. paprika

Preparation

Step 1

Combine salt, pepper and cayenne. Rub over pork butt. Place pork in slow cooker and cook on low for 8 to 10 hours or until meat is done and tender.

For sauce, melt butter in 2 quart saucepan. Add ketchup, pineapple juice, brown sugar, molasses and paprika, boil for 5 minutes.

Remove pork and drippings from slow cooker. Discard drippings. On a cutting board, pull apart the meat. Return the pork to the slow cooker. Pour in the sauce and stir. Cook on low for 1 hour.

Serve on buns. Yummmmmm!!!!
